Warhorse Studios Co-Founder Criticizes Unreal Engine 5 for Open-World Game Development
Daniel Vávra, co-founder of Warhorse Studios, the studio which created Kingdom Come Deliverance, has expressed skepticism about using Unreal Engine 5 for open-world game development. In an interview from February 2024, Vávra highlighted challenges associated with the engine, particularly its suitability for expansive, open-world environments.
Vávra noted that, at the time, Unreal Engine 5 struggled with certain aspects crucial to open-world games, such as efficient terrain and vegetation generation. He mentioned that while features like Nanite have improved, enabling better handling of vegetation, the engine was initially more suited for creating static environments like rocks rather than dynamic, expansive terrains.
He also referenced discussions with developers from CD Projekt RED, who transitioned to Unreal Engine 5 for their upcoming title, 'The Witcher 4.' According to Vávra, despite the engine's advancements, there were still significant hurdles in implementing open-world functionalities, even a year or two into development.
